Abstract

This paper introduces printed monopole antenna designs which are suitable for a microwave head scanner. The designs feature compact size and a wide bandwidth of operation which is relevant to microwave medical imaging applications (from 0.3GHz to above 4GHz). To assess the efficiency of these designs to operate as elements of microwave imaging (MWI) arrays, we first compare the signals received by an 8-element array of 150 mm diameter. The array is immersed in a lossy glycerine-water mixture medium which accounts for the strong attenuation that signals would experience when propagating inside the head.
